Harvest Mocktail Explosion

Who needs a little liquid courage when you’ve got this festive refresher? This Harvest Mocktail Explosion is packed with autumn flavors that will have you feeling merry without the hangover.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 1 cup apple cider
  • ½ cup sparkling water
  • 1/4 cup cranberry juice
  • Fresh rosemary sprigs
  • Apple slices for garnish

Mix the apple cider and cranberry juice in a shaker, then pour over ice in your favorite festive glass. Top it off with sparkling water, add an apple slice, and a sprig of rosemary for that extra Thanksgiving flair. Sip it slowly; you might just confuse the family into thinking you’re sipping on the real deal!

Pumpkin Spice Fizz

Put your coffee cravings on hold and embrace the bubbly goodness of the Pumpkin Spice Fizz. It’s a drink so delicious, it might get even the most hardcore coffee lovers to reconsider. Ingredients include:

  • 1/2 cup pumpkin puree
  • 1 cup ginger ale
  • 1 tsp pumpkin pie spice
  • Whipped cream (optional)

In a bowl, stir the pumpkin puree and pumpkin pie spice until well mixed. Pour this mixture into a glass and top with ginger ale. A dollop of whipped cream never hurt anyone – except maybe those calorie counters! This fizzy delight will leave you bouncing off the walls, every bit as festive as your turkey centerpiece.

Thanksgiving Berry Blast

Let’s face it: cranberries are underrated. With the Thanksgiving Berry Blast, we’re about to elevate this humble fruit to stardom. All you need for this potion of cheer is:

  • 1 cup mixed berries (frozen or fresh)
  • 1 cup lemonade
  • 2 cups soda water
  • Basil leaves for garnish

Blend the mixed berries into a puree and strain it into a pitcher. Add the lemonade and soda water, give it a little stir, and voilà! Serve it over ice with a sprig of basil for a touch of gourmet. You’ll be more berry than merry, and isn’t that the goal of every Thanksgiving gathering?

Traditional Drink Non-Alcoholic Twist
Eggnog Chilled spiced almond milk with whipped cream
Mulled Wine Warm spiced apple cider with cloves and cinnamon
Cocktail Spritz Herb-infused sparkling water with a splash of juice
